Saptak Talwar Eyes India Championship Breakthrough for Indian Golf
Saptak Talwar is currently the leading golfer on India’s main professional tour.
He hopes to use a major upcoming tournament to reach the next level.
The DP World India Championship has a $4 million prize fund.
Some of the world’s best golfers are expected to play in it.
The event will also help decide which Indian golfers receive important opportunities.
The top 24 players in a new points race will qualify for the 2026 championship.
The top 60 players will keep their tour playing rights for 2027.
Talwar will miss the Kapil Dev Invitational because he is playing at the Asian Games.
He believes the championship could inspire more Indian golfers to win internationally.
Saptak Talwar leads the Professional Golf Tour of India Order of Merit ahead of the DP World India Championship.
The $4 million championship will feature stars including Rory McIlroy, Tommy Fleetwood and Viktor Hovland.
The top 24 players in the new Race to DP World India Championship will qualify for the 2026 event.
The top 60 players in the Order of Merit will retain Professional Golf Tour of India playing rights for 2027.
Talwar says the tournament could transform Indian golf, while only one-quarter of its prize money will count toward the Order of Merit.

Key facts
- Prize fund
- $4 million, the highest prize fund in India for the second consecutive year
- Current leader
- Saptak Talwar leads Jhared Hack by more than Rs. 20 lakhs
- Leading Indian
- Talwar is more than Rs. 30 lakhs ahead of Honey Baisoya
- Qualification
- The top 24 players in the standings will qualify for the 2026 DP World India Championship
- Playing rights
- The top 60 players on the Order of Merit will retain Professional Golf Tour of India rights for 2027
- Order of Merit rule
- Only one-quarter of the DP World India Championship prize money will count toward the Professional Golf Tour of India Order of Merit
- Asian Games team
- Talwar, Yuvraj Sandhu and Veer Ahlawat will represent India in the three-man golf team
